Owner of Pachikweza Radio Station Gabriel Kondesi will join Kaphuka Private Schools in November, Kondesi's father Jonas confirmed on Wednesday.
“He will not be able to join the school on November 2 when they are opening for the first term. He wants to finish roofing the house which will be used as the radio station because he is also a carpenter. “He will therefore join his colleagues on November 5 after completing the house for the radio equipment installation,” Jonasi said. Managing Director for Kaphuka Private Schools Jackson Kaphuka also confirmed the scholarship in an interview on Wednesday. The scholarships covers both primary and secondary school levels. “We learnt about the issue of Gabriel through the media. We therefore also disclosed our offer of scholarships to him through the same media first before we wrote him,” he said. Kondesi is a Standard 7 drop out. Malawi Communications Regulatory Authority (Macra) granted the community where Pachikweza radio operated a broadcasting licence on Tuesday. Macra also pledged to install modern radio equipment valued about K10 million at the station. A Mulanje court earlier this month convicted Kondesi for operating the radio station illegally.
